Poole Borough (2) 3, Gillingham Town (2) 3. Dorset Premier League Saturday 15th April 2006 Borough Scorers: Alex Allen 37, 39; OG Borough and Gillingham shared the points in a six-goal thriller at Turlin Moor. Gillingham took the lead after only six minutes when Borough keeper Doug Shear miskicked a clearance and presented Ian Williamson with a simple chance to score. Borough were forced to defend and Sean Hebdon cleared off the line from a corner, but they nearly equalised on twenty minutes when Dan Chapple headed a cross from Gary Fooks goalwards but keeper Darren Wakely dived to turn the ball round the post. Gillingham extended their lead after twenty-nine minutes when Nick Thompson crashed the ball home from close range. A minute later a deflected Williamson shot was acrobatically tipped over by Shear. Borough fought back with two goals in two minutes to level the score. Alex Allen headed home a cross from Andy Barham on thirty-seven minutes and then Allen bundled home a cross from Aaron Woldon with the Gills defence protesting for offside. Half Time 2-2 Gillingham pressed forward in the second-half and were unlucky when a looping long range shot cleared Shear but hit the inside of the post and rebounded along the line to hit the other post before being cleared by Hebdon. It was Borough, however, who took the lead after seventy-two minutes when Wakely under pressure from Woldon punched a corner into his own net. Within three minutes Gillingham equalised when a cross was headed back across goal for Thompson to score. Gillingham pumped balls into the Borough goalmouth looking for the winner but Borough's defence held on for a deserved draw. Borough: Doug Shear, Gary Fooks.
